Commit Graph

212 Commits

Author SHA1 Message Date
artdeell
16550344e7 Logcat logging 2020-09-10 17:35:58 +03:00
khanhduytran0
c450afe458 Completely remove .jar patcher 2020-09-10 18:59:29 +07:00
khanhduytran0
a54e605e73 Use Apache Commons IOUtils to read byte array; cleanup unused parts 2020-09-10 18:50:41 +07:00
khanhduytran0
e71fc849e3 Improve byte array reader; Attempt fix input not working 2020-09-10 18:18:08 +07:00
khanhduytran0
464479cac2 Debug input 2020-09-10 15:10:19 +07:00
khanhduytran0
0fee980626 Fix extract... 2020-09-10 12:32:51 +07:00
khanhduytran0
b344fee33a Dismiss dialog on select JRE OpenJDK tar.xz 2020-09-10 12:24:26 +07:00
khanhduytran0
e8299920d0 Cleanup unused codes; Add java runtime installer 2020-09-10 11:39:30 +07:00
khanhduytran0
ca58191935 Disable LWJGL lookup logging; Prepare for JRE installer 2020-09-10 09:28:12 +07:00
khanhduytran0
74938b2be4 Limit default -Xmx value to 900mb 2020-09-09 15:20:43 +07:00
khanhduytran0
130ea87366 Catch an exception 2020-09-09 13:11:13 +07:00
khanhduytran0
42357626cf Fix OutOfMemory after enable Log output 2020-09-09 13:09:12 +07:00
khanhduytran0
816c0ad709 Fix crash 2020-09-09 12:41:30 +07:00
khanhduytran0
7045371568 Allow load custom OpenGL library: Regal 2020-09-09 12:34:30 +07:00
khanhduytran0
5bf7e11127 Custom java args: fix crash, remove infinity GC interval 2020-09-09 11:53:21 +07:00
khanhduytran0
1690938b3b Fix custom java args not take effect; Allow override java properties 2020-09-09 05:29:13 +07:00
khanhduytran0
ab662dbbce Remove duplicate settings Activity 2020-09-08 19:28:17 +07:00
khanhduytran0
80261db3ac Update input type index; forget say: added custom JVM arguments 2020-09-08 19:04:50 +07:00
khanhduytran0
41e3207d38 Add a pipe to send input event; Clean LWJGL2 2020-09-08 19:02:52 +07:00
khanhduytran0
fcfc4f16cb Fix log 2020-09-08 13:59:47 +07:00
khanhduytran0
b5782d5d4e Load gl4es before lwjgl 2020-09-08 06:32:08 +07:00
khanhduytran0
84d39544ee Remove awt_xawt 2020-09-07 16:22:23 +07:00
khanhduytran0
88ab3875b5 Move run java runtime mode 2020-09-07 14:44:21 +07:00
khanhduytran0
94c08b52a5 Move java launch to another place 2020-09-07 13:19:24 +07:00
khanhduytran0
ea4002f0a2 Start porting libawt_xawt.so to Android 2020-09-07 13:18:17 +07:00
khanhduytran0
9bcf2de57c Merge branch 'v3_openjdk' of https://github.com/khanhduytran0/PojavLauncher.git into v3_openjdk 2020-09-06 06:43:10 +07:00
khanhduytran0
18a25e0343 Remove toast...... 2020-09-06 06:43:04 +07:00
khanhduytran0
2f0f4f8ee6 Move some native codes to there 2020-09-04 15:27:56 +07:00
khanhduytran0
976c43536c Update lib for another attempt 2020-09-04 12:32:18 +07:00
khanhduytran0
139064fdc9 Change to Xbootclasspath for caciocavallo 2020-09-02 05:07:09 +07:00
khanhduytran0
af3cc21fd5 Fix build error; add override cacio argd 2020-09-01 10:48:03 +07:00
khanhduytran0
db9dcbd131 cacioawt check exists 2020-09-01 10:28:50 +07:00
khanhduytran0
a2e62939c6 Append caciocavallo lib 2020-09-01 10:24:50 +07:00
khanhduytran0
da050942f8 Update lib; share surface using pointer 2020-09-01 10:18:43 +07:00
khanhduytran0
79f513a25f Fix error 2020-09-01 07:58:03 +07:00
khanhduytran0
958e22f0a3 Add mod installer (not implemented) 2020-09-01 07:32:54 +07:00
khanhduytran0
bf49d40eb7 Change lib 2020-08-31 11:52:54 +07:00
khanhduytran0
e6ea54740d Make Boardwalk2's JRE9 runtime works on this launcher 2020-08-30 05:53:54 +07:00
khanhduytran0
f2d44e8f14 LD_LIBRARY_PATH: Put lib/server to first path to make libjli.so ignore re-execute 2020-08-29 09:37:56 +07:00
khanhduytran0
002dd96a55 Fix OpenJDK? 2020-08-29 09:27:35 +07:00
khanhduytran0
2f2d74a8b0 Allow override launch type, set some env if neee 2020-08-29 07:42:57 +07:00
khanhduytran0
c55cddf6f1 Replace execute binary with 'JNI_CreateJavaVM' 2020-08-28 14:45:43 +07:00
khanhduytran0
4918d8d8c4 Update 2020-08-28 05:23:35 +07:00
khanhduytran0
dde2ce9152 Fix build error, update README.md 2020-08-27 18:08:26 +07:00
khanhduytran0
b25e8ebf34 setupBridgeEGL 2020-08-27 17:51:18 +07:00
khanhduytran0
332f8c300d Smaller code set LD_LIBRARY_PATH 2020-08-27 17:42:40 +07:00
khanhduytran0
ea8caa3cd9 setEnvironment: (value part) replace some env with direct value 2020-08-27 17:40:22 +07:00
khanhduytran0
46f9d1aa88 Attempt to 'JLI_Launch' for JVDroid OpenJDK 2020-08-27 17:37:07 +07:00
khanhduytran0
588594d2d8 Merge branch 'v3_openjdk' of https://github.com/PojavLauncherTeam/PojavLauncher into v3_openjdk 2020-08-27 08:38:34 +07:00
khanhduytran0
ed7be8ef6a Try new way set LD_LIBRARY_PATH for JLI Invocation 2020-08-27 08:37:13 +07:00